Hey, youre right! I shoulda known....
Toyota/Yamaha DOHC I6 with 3 Solex/Mikuni 40PHH's....
1988cc (2.0L)...Huh....Known as the 3M....
Interesting....A square-bore motor...75mm x 75mm (3.0" x 3.0")...Guess thats where the nice torque rating comes from...
Wow!...Looks like max HP is rated at 8100RPM!....And max torque at 7000RPM!
Wonder what the redline was?....
Like i said, i know the numbers for a carbed 7MG would be lower than a 7MGE, but i bet would still be very impressive, and cool to see "Just Because!"...LOL |
